      Is it possible to add alpha masks to active scenes? I have a video running (in an activated scene) and I want to change the alpha mask a couple times. I could sent it to a virtual stage in the background and then get stage image and put a mask on it from there, but is there an easier way?

        Broadcaster and Listener will send data/video between scenes that are active.

          @charlotte_e said:

          virtual stage in the background and then get stage image and put a mask on it from there

           This sounds like a smart way to extend your video pipeline. Or create a User Actor that is inserted before the projector in the scene and allows you to add an alpha channel. You could use listener broadcasters to insert any alpha you like from any other scene in that way.
